Ly Hoang Nam entered the singles semi-finals and doubles final of the Indian youth tournament.

April 17, 2015 07:52

Vietnam's number one tennis player is getting closer to winning the double youth championship in Malaysia last month.

In the men's doubles semi-final on April 16, Ly Hoang Nam/Alberto Lim defeated the Japanese pair Yuya Ito/Yusuke Takahashi in two sets with a score of 6-4, 6-3. With this result, they won the right to play in the final, meeting the pair Sora Fukuda/Renta Tokuda also from the land of the rising sun. In which Tokuda is the second seeded player.

Hoang Nam is currently ranked 32nd among the world's top young tennis players. Photo: Duc Dong.

Along with his rise in doubles, Hoang Nam also achieved success in singles. The 1997-born player won the right to play in the semi-finals after defeating Yaya Ito in the quarter-finals on April 16. In the first set, Hoang Nam defeated his opponent with a score of 6-3, before winning 6-0 in the second set.

The doubles final and singles semi-finals with Hoang Nam will take place on April 17.

The junior tournament in India that Hoang Nam participated in was the Asian Closed Junior, which is in group B1 of the International Tennis Federation (ITF). Hoang Nam was seeded number one in this tournament.

By reaching the doubles final and singles semi-finals, Hoang Nam is closer to achieving the double championship achievement of a month ago at the junior tournament in Malaysia. Hoang Nam's partner at that time was also Filipino player Alberto Lim.

If he wins this tournament, Hoang Nam will have a great chance to enter the Top 25 young tennis players in the world. Currently, his position is 32.
